Web2 de jul. de 2024 · The antral follicle count (AFC) is the number of antral follicles visible on an ultrasound scan of your ovaries. Fertility doctors use the AFC to estimate your ovarian reserve or the number of eggs you have left in your body. In other words, it measures egg quantity, not quality.
